After booking a flight, flyers can pull up the new all-in-one portal through the "My Trips" function, both on the mobile app and on United.com. Once United verifies the record is authentic and is compared to the name and date of birth of the person traveling, it will compare the vaccine type and dates against government requirements. After allowing Apple to share the data with United, the airline's system will read the vaccine type, vaccine dates, name, and date of birth on the shared record. VeriFLY compiles real-time wellness information from self-certified health questionnaires and/or diagnostic COVID-19 test results from over 20,000 performing labs and provides digital badging, proof of test status for both antibody or viral testing, and (in the future) proof of vaccine.
